Transaction 87425b3dc93b5f6abcb97ed95d46beb29d12de6f10f9e9e697d6b913a10db14b
1 Input
1 Output
-
87425b3dc93b5f6abcb97ed95d46beb29d12de6f10f9e9e697d6b913a10db14b:0
- value
- 301526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 527f570c0c5548892eab495ac78e9c1e43f6d21b OP_EQUAL
- address
- 39DDt1mc9xjBikfEJhndd4cScJWvWLT2bu